About AbCheck
AbCheck s.r.o., founded in 2009, specializes in custom antibody discovery and screening activities for therapeutic applications. The technology portfolio is based on three different human antibody libraries and covers all aspects of product candidate generation from early stage research to lead optimization. The use of three highly diversified libraries enables AbCheck to isolate highly specific human antibodies against almost any target from a portfolio of over ten billion different antibodies. The company has isolated more than 25 different therapeutic antibody candidates, characterized by high affinity and specificity, against the most difficult targets. AbCheck s.r.o. is a spin-off of Affimed Therapeutics AG based in the Technology Park Pilsen, Czech Republic.

Topic world Antibodies
Antibodies are specialized molecules of our immune system that can specifically recognize and neutralize pathogens or foreign substances. Antibody research in biotech and pharma has recognized this natural defense potential and is working intensively to make it therapeutically useful. From monoclonal antibodies used against cancer or autoimmune diseases to antibody-drug conjugates that specifically transport drugs to disease cells - the possibilities are enormous
